Product Features and Specifications

The Voyager Self Balancing Kick Scooter boasts an impressive array of features that cater to young riders.

Its light-up wheels add a fun element, making every ride exciting. I appreciate the extra-wide deck, providing stability and comfort while riding.

The three-wheel platform guarantees a secure experience for kids aged three and up, with a weight limit of 75 lbs. The foot-activated brake offers an easy way to stop safely.

Weighing only 4.6 lbs and measuring 22.5L x 5.8W x 9.8H inches, it’s compact and lightweight, perfect for little explorers enthusiastic to zip around!

Customer Feedback and Ratings

While exploring the Voyager Self Balancing Kick Scooter, I was keen to plunge into what other customers thought about it. I found the average rating stood at 3.9 out of 5 stars, based on 2,832 reviews.

Many praised its smooth ride and easy assembly, highlighting how much fun their kids had. However, some voiced concerns about wheel durability and the light activation needing higher speeds.

A few even mentioned assembly struggles. Overall, it seems like a solid choice for kids, but it’s good to be aware of these common issues before making a purchase.
